    By "caterers," do you mean venues where the food is included (on-site catering), or are you looking for a food company who will prepare and deliver food to a site (outside catering)?

    If you're looking for on-site catering, there are many options here, but you need to tell us your budget and style preferences.

    If you're looking for off-site catering, there are very few venues here that will allow you to do this, although they do exist.

    We are using In Thyme Catering, they are located in River Vale and work out of the Florentine Gardens.  The food is delicious.  They have been great to work with and really take time for us. They worked with our budget and made a menu that was exactly what we wanted.

    We met with The Market Basket and they were so rude.  I was so surprised because of all the good reviews.  It took going there 3 times before they actually were willing to sit down and discuss our wedding and not just go over the basic catering menu.  The woman we met with did not listen to what we wanted and just kept saying we should do what she wants.  The worst thing was after the meeting she told us she get a proposal to us in a few weeks (most places took a week max), but I was ok with that.  After a month passed and still no word I followed up at that point it was around Thanksgiving and was told they wouldn't be able to get back to us until JANUARY because they were in there busy season. I felt completely unimportant.  The only reason I followed about again in February was to find out what their cost would be.  If you meet with them make sure you keep on top of them or they will just blow over you.

    kjones927- would you be able to tell me about how many people you have and how much if possible is your budget was for catering?
  • edited December 2011
    We are planning on 120 and our budget for catering was around $12000.  What was nice about this caterer is that our cost also included all the servingware and tableware.  When meeting with caterers some put on the very less page that there are additional costs for all of those things.
